Why estimating private net worth is difficult

For private professionals, net worth estimation is challenging because:

  • Salaries are not public
  • Investment portfolios are private
  • Business equity is often undisclosed
  • Lifestyle does not necessarily reflect wealth

Unlike celebrities, private individuals may deliberately avoid signaling financial status, making public assumptions unreliable.

Income versus wealth

A critical distinction is the difference between income and wealth. Darnton’s career likely provided steady income growth, but net worth increased primarily through saving, investing, and compounding rather than dramatic paydays.

This approach produces less visible wealth early on, but stronger financial resilience over time.
